We celebrate Halloween on October 31st.

Halloween combines different traditions and lots of fun.

Halloween is also known as All Hallows' Eve, and it's actually been around for centuries

in one form or another.

Halloween has ancient Celtic roots, so the holiday came from what is now Ireland, the

UK, and France.

At this time of the year, when the warm summer ends, and the cold weather sets in, people

believed that the line between the living and the dead blurs.

That's how Halloween came into existence.

This is a celebration of a historical event and it dates back to the year 1605.

King James was the king of Great Britain and some people planned to assassinate him - so

to kill him.

They got barrels of gunpowder and hid them in the British parliament building and waited

for the king to arrive.

So it was a plot.

They planned to blow up the building and kill the king.

However, the king's supporters heard about the plot.

They searched the building and discovered a man, called Guy Fawkes, hiding in the basement

under the building with 36 barrels of gunpowder.

So the king was saved and the people of London celebrated by lighting bonfires.

That's how the tradition started.

Every November the fifth we have bonfires and lots of fireworks.

When I was a child, bonfire night was probably the most exciting night of the year.

Preparations started a week or two before.

We'd go to the shop and buy big boxes of fireworks and very importantly, we'd make

a guy.

A guy is a kind of effigy or model of Guy Fawkes.

We'd get some old clothes, stuff them with newspapers and sew them together so they looked

like a human body.

Then we'd build a bonfire, put the guy on top and set fire to it.

Gasoline tax increase $.10 it might be

interesting for everybody to know that according

to the Utah foundation the amount of money that

we spend the percentage of our income to the

gasoline tax is the lowest it's ever been since the

inception of the gasoline tax in 1929. So, our

proportion of our money we are spending into

gasoline is the lowest it's ever been on the tax,

so we haven't really kept up with inflation and

purchasing power of the tax so it's probably

smart to do anyways. In good policy. If you want

to build roads what we've been doing, though is

robbing the general fund monies to pay for

roads. It should be going to education. I'm so

what will happen is both issues will be

addressed with this gasoline tax. 75% will be

going to the classroom and schools helping us

with education teacher salaries those kind of

things will help improve our educational

achievement for our students and 25% will go

into roads and road maintenance which were

deficient on so it's win-win. It's something we

ought to do so. I hope people will vote for

question number one.
